Cracked Foundation Repair in Paola, KS
Cracked foundation repair services address issues related to structural damage caused by shifting, settling, or other foundational problems. These projects typically involve assessing the extent of the cracks, determining their causes, and implementing appropriate solutions such as underpinning, mudjacking, or wall stabilization. Property owners often seek this service when noticing visible cracks in basement walls,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, as these signs can indicate underlying foundation concerns that may affect the safety and stability of a home.

Common Cracked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ural issues.
Wall stabilization - reinforces bowing or leaning basement walls for added safety.
Pier and underpinning services - lifts and stabilizes uneven or sinking foundations.
Mudjacking and foam leveling - restores proper foundation height and prevents settling.
Drainage correction - manages water flow to reduce soil pressure on the foundation.
Structural reinforcement - strengthens compromised foundation components for long-term stability.
Cracked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of a cracked foundation?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that don’t close properly.
Why is it important to repair a cracked foundation? Repairing cracks helps prevent further damage, maintains structural integrity, and protects property value.
What types of foundation cracks require repair? Both minor surface cracks and larger, structural cracks should be evaluated and repaired to ensure stability.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, underpinning, or installing supports to stabilize the foundation.
